1. Kirin Ichiban
Japanese lagers are distinctively dry and crisp, and Kirin Ichiban is a great example of how they can still pack in a whole lot of flavour. Smooth and rich, this is a full-bodied style, but still with that clean finish.
Stick with the Japanese theme and pair this with sushi and sashimi or a hearty ramen, but it will go just as well with a humble sausage in bread.
2. Coors Original
If you caught the American football bug with the big NFL game at the MCG, this is the beer for it. This classic American lager is smooth and full flavoured, with a subtle malt sweetness, toasted notes and a crisp finish.
This beer is crying out for a hot dog with the works – cheese, mustard, onions, relish… More is more.
3. Mountain Culture Juice Trip Blood Orange
A fruit-enhanced hazy? When celebrated brewery Mountain Culture turns their hand to something, you know it’s worth a go. Described as a “blood orange flavour bomb”, this is a sharp and juicy take on the pale ale.
That bright citrus kick will cut right through anything spicy or fried – or both – so take your pick. We’re putting this with a fried chicken burger loaded with hot sauce.
4. Miller Dry 3.5%
Not done with American brews? This mid-strength is a lower-carb pick that’s as smooth and crisp as you want from a lager. It’s all about easy drinking here, and we love a can that’s one standard drink, too.
You can’t go wrong with food for this beer as it suits just about everything. Go US-style with a burger and fries or sip it in the sunshine with friends over a big plate of cheeses.

6. Asahi Zeitaku Shibori Peach
For another delicate fruity number, this new vodka and soda mix has a good hit of peach flavour in this fresh, sparkling drink, and it’s low in sugar, too. A great choice for anyone who doesn’t love an overly sweet premix.
This is the sort of can that belongs in an esky, so it’s likely to show up all season – ideally alongside a spread of crisps, corn chips and a few spicy dips.
